10 BURNS CLOSE is a midsized extended detached house of 114m², built sometime between 1983 and 1990, which could now be worth an estimated £333,334. It was last sold for £187,500 in August 2009, which was around 9% below the average August 2009 detached price in the Liverpool local authority area. The most recent EPC inspection was February 2013, where the current energy rating was C, and the potential energy rating was B.

What might 10 BURNS CLOSE be worth now?

10 BURNS CLOSE might now be worth an estimated £333,334.

This is based on house price inflation of 77.8%, between August 2009 and February 2025, for detached houses, in the Liverpool local authority area, as calculated by the Office for National Statistics and published in their UK House Price Index (HPI).

The 77.8% inflationary increase is applied to the most recent sale price for 10 BURNS CLOSE of £187,500 on 7th August 2009. For the value to have increased from £187,500 to £333,334 over the sixteen years and six months to February 2025, the following assumptions must hold true:

  • The value of 10 BURNS CLOSE has moved in line with the HPI for detached houses in the Liverpool local authority area.
  • The August 2009 sale price of £187,500 represented a fair market value for the property.
  • The size, condition, and specification of 10 BURNS CLOSE has not materially changed since August 2009.
